Major computer manufacturers like Dell, HP, and Lenovo pre-install Windows on millions of machines using a method called "Offline Activation." These machines have a specific SLIC code embedded in their BIOS. When Windows starts, it looks for this code; if it finds a match, it activates automatically without needing to connect to the internet. The Daz Loader functions as a "bootloader." Before the operating system even loads, the tool injects a virtual SLIC into the system's memory.
